Hintergrund
Rgs10 inhibits signal transduction by increasing the GTPase activity of G protein alpha subunits thereby driving them into their inactive GDP-bound form. Rgs10 associates specifically with the activated forms of the G protein subunits G(i)-alpha and G(z)-alpha but fails to interact with the structurally and functionally distinct G(s)-alpha subunit. Activity of Rgs10 on G(z)-alpha is inhibited by palmitoylation of the G-protein.
